Published Date: 05 July 2008
GLASGOW rivals Celtic and Rangers are to battle for Watford defender Danny Shittu, Peter Crouch is set to seal a move from Liverpool to Portsmouth and Real Madrid and Manchester United continue to battle for Cristiano Ronaldo.
TRANSFER RUMOURS

Portsmouth are set to seal the signing of Liverpool striker Peter Crouch after Pompey relented on the Reds' asking price of £10m. - Daily Mail

England forward Peter Crouch will move from Merseyside to the south coast on Monday when he joins Portsmouth from Liverpool in an £11m deal. - The Sun

Portsmouth boss Harry Redknapp looks like he has finally get his man with Liverpool's Peter Crouch heading back to Fratton Park in an £8.75m deal. - Daily Express

Watford's £2m-rated Nigeria defender Danny Shittu is a target for deadly Scottish Premier League rivals Celtic and Rangers. - The Scottish Sun

Serie A left-back Vitorino Gabriel Antunes has welcomed the prospect of a move from Roma to Celtic. "If something happens that allows me to come to Glasgow I would be playing for a massive club in the Champions League," he said. - Daily Record

Manchester United can expect an offer of £70m on Monday from Spanish giants Real Madrid. - Daily Mirror

Sir Alex Ferguson's Manchester United believe they have won their fight with Real Madrid to keep Portugal international star Cristiano Ronaldo. - Daily Mail

Catalan giants Barcelona continue to lead the race to land Arsenal striker Emmanuel Adebayor for a quoted figure of £30m. - The Independent

Andrei Arshavin's club Zenit St Petersburg have informed both Chelsea and Barcelona they want £20m for the Russian attacking midfielder and not the £12m the two clubs have reportedly offered. - Daily Express

Newcastle United have been rocked by striker Obafemi Martins who is targeting a move to Arsenal this summer. - The Sun

Atletico Madrid are poised to move in for Everton midfielder Mikel Arteta. - The Sun

Manchester City have emerged as favourites to land Turkey's £4m-rated Euro 2008 star Colin Kazam-Richards. - The Sun

Fulham are expected to launch a £1.5m bid for Sweden defender Fredrik Stoor next week. - The Sun

Chelsea are set to sell defender Branislav Ivanovic to Juventus. - Daily Express

Newcastle boss Kevin Keegan is closing in on a £4m deal for Switzerland midfielder Gokhan Inler. - Daily Mirror

Everton rejected Fulham's £5m bid for Andy Johnson, who is also attracting Wigan boss Steve Bruce. - Daily Mail

Manchester City's hopes of signing Ronaldinho are fading fast as he is 90% certain of joining AC Milan. - Daily Express

Wigan boss Steve Bruce is set to buy Olivier Kapo from his old club Birmingham in a deal worth £3.5m. - Daily Mirror

Wigan are close to finalising a deal for Croatia striker Ivan Klasnic on a free transfer. - Daily Mail

FA Cup hero Kanu is close to agreeing a one-year contract with Portsmouth after going back on his demands for a second year. - Daily Mirror

Galatasaray are interested in West Ham defender Lucas Neil. - Daily Mail

West Brom boss Tony Mowbray expects to find out over the weekend whether veteran striker Kevin Phillips will stay with the club or join Birmingham. - The Independent

West Brom have made an inquiry about Tottenham goalkeeper Paul Robinson. - The Guardian

Plymouth manager Paul Sturrock is ready to sign goalkeeper Graham Stack, who has been freed by Reading. - Daily Mail

Hull boss Phil Brown is weighing up a move for Manchester City reject Emile Mpenza. - Daily Mirror

Brown is also keen on Plymouth winger Peter Halmosi and Manchester City midfielder Geovanni. - Daily Mail

Stoke City manager Tony Pulis is trying to push through a £1.5m deal for Ipswich striker Jon Walters. - Daily Mirror

Blackburn have attempted to sabotage Steven Davis' move to Rangers by tabling a £3m bid for the Fulham midfielder. - Daily Record



FOOTBALL GOSSIP

Manchester United have been contacted by several leading European clubs, including Barcelona, to make a stand against Real Madrid and resist selling Cristiano Ronaldo. - Daily Mail

Real Madrid's players will revolt in protest if the club signs Ronaldo, saying his arrival could have a negative impact on team spirit. - Daily Express
